Description

About Job

Ideate and formulate a pragmatic blueprint for .Net development platform solution and subsequent development using .Net, C#, ASP.net Core, Angular, SQL with a cross-functional team of talented engineers, Motivated self-learner. 

Collaborate well with engineers, researchers, and data implementation specialists to design and create advanced, elegant, and efficient .Net, Angular based solutions for business problems. 

Implement best practices in coding, collaborating, and maintaining code repositories. 

Maintain quality and ensure responsiveness of .Net, C#, Angular based platforms. 

Provide real time knowledge transfer to the team on the Requirements based on client facing meetings and white boarding workshops. 

Help in writing a comprehensive proposal with the help of the other engineers on the project. 

Work in an agile environment based on the defined sprint backlogs to deliver the assigned work in the stipulated timelines. 

Adhere to software development best practices and coding standards in all work products and participate in the refinement of those practices and standards to improve quality and productivity. 

Work collaboratively with a cross functional team of engineers under the guidance of a Lead / Senior .Net Full stack platform development stream. 

Required skills. 

Very strong engineering degree in Computer Science/or other engineering discipline from top tier schools. 

Strong problem-solving skills with an emphasis on analytical thinking 

A drive to learn and master new technologies and techniques. 

Excellent communication and presentation skills 

 

Tools & Technologies 

Very strong skills in   

Angular 13 or above,  

ASP.NET Core 6/7 

Restful API / Web API Concepts 

SQL coding 

C# Programming Skills & OOPS Concepts, Logical Reasoning 

Strong programming skills 

Understanding of Version Control (Git), Azure DevOps is desired. 

Education

Any Graduate